At France 2005, the tongs turned IchakdanaBichakdana into a game. The way to play it goes something along these lines:
- Think of an object. This is usually something you can see, because we are lazy.
- Make a weak riddle around it. Usually this is done by characterising the object as an 'old man' (e.g. a tree) or a 'young girl' (e.g. a candle).
- Stand up and do the dance. Start waggling your right finger, and waggle your hips in a very exagerrated fashion. Then lift one of your legs and waggle that in the air. While doing this, sing IchakdanaBichakdana.
- Read out the riddle. In a diversion from the song, this is done in English.
- Ask people to say what they think it is. Make the KyaHandShape, and scream bolo bolo?.
- Watch the French people looking confused.
Hints
- The person doing the riddling is usually looking directly at the object when s/he says the riddle.
- Try to make your riddle symbolic, otherwise it's very obvious indeed. For example, She is an old tree whose roots wind around the land, and metal ants crawl along her.. Bolo Bolo? It's a motorway.
